This is an application under Section 439 of the Code of Criminal

Procedure for grant of interim bail to the petitioner on the ground that

she has to undergo surgery.

The petitioner had filed another application being Bail Application

No.1219/2008 seeking interim bail to undergo surgery in a private

hospital for removal of gallbladder stone. By order dated 10th June,

2008, the petitioner was granted interim bail for a period of one month

from the date of her release with the clarification that if the surgery for
